NOMINATION HIGHLIGHTS
As organizations deploy AI agents that take autonomous actions, interact with enterprise tools, and execute multi-step workflows, governance has become one of the most pressing challenges in enterprise AI. Airia is the AI governance platform purpose-built to provide centralized oversight, policy enforcement, and continuous risk monitoring across the full lifecycle of agentic AI.
Airia addresses the growing need for active governance, meaning the ability to not just assess and document AI risk, but to intervene, enforce, and audit in real time. The platform delivers three integrated capabilities that set it apart.
Comprehensive AI and Agent Discovery
Airia provides enterprise-wide visibility into where and how AI is being used, spanning internally built models, embedded SaaS AI, third-party applications, and agentic systems. Discovery runs across browser extensions, network integrations, code scanning, DNS, identity layer logs, and cloud platforms including AWS Bedrock and Azure AI Foundry. Every discovered asset feeds a living inventory that drives automated risk classification, policy assignment, and lifecycle controls.
Policy Management and Enforcement at Scale
Airia enables AI governance leaders to define policies centrally and enforce them consistently across all AI, regardless of where it was built or deployed. Through its AI Gateway and MCP Gateway, Airia applies guardrails and agent constraints to external agents and third-party tools, not just AI built within the platform. Risk-based workflows, human-in-the-loop approvals, and role-based access controls allow organizations to govern who can build, publish, and deploy AI agents, with full auditability at every step.
Governance Built for Agentic AI Specifically
Airia goes beyond model-level governance to address the unique risks of autonomous agents. Agent constraints provide hardcoded behavioral boundaries that persist regardless of runtime instructions or manipulation attempts. Tool execution alignment checking monitors whether an agent’s actions match its stated purpose and the user’s intent, catching misuse and indirect attacks that conventional guardrails miss. Pre-built regulatory packs covering the EU AI Act, NIST AI RMF, and ISO 42001 accelerate compliance readiness, while automated reporting supports both internal governance teams and external regulators.
Recognized in Gartner’s Market Guide for AI Governance and Forrester’s Landscape for AI Governance Platforms, Airia is helping enterprises in regulated industries scale agentic AI responsibly, with the transparency and accountability that stakeholders require.
